TX-6

Ultra-portable pro-mixer and audio interface.

Effect Send Level (FX I)
Controls the amount of signal sent to the FX I effect processor.
Effect Return Level (FX I)
Controls the amount of processed signal from FX I returned to the mix.
Chorus Presets
Offers 'subtle', 'medium', and 'strong' chorus effect settings.
Reverb Presets
Includes 'light', 'small', 'medium', 'large', and 'drone' reverb options.
Delay Presets
Provides delay times including 1/8, 1/4, 1/2, 2/3, 3/4, 1, 3/2, plus 'warp' and 'mash' modes.
Tremolo
Applies a tremolo effect for amplitude modulation.
Freeze
A delay effect that can freeze audio.
Tape Presets
Includes 'stop1', 'stop2', and 'pong' tape emulation effects.
Filter Effect
Applies a filter effect, likely resonant or sweeping.
Distortion Presets
Offers 'push', 'drive', 'blow', and 'dstroy' distortion types.
Crush Presets
Includes 'shape', 'bend', 'chip', and 'bit' bitcrusher/degrader effects.

2+2 Channel USB Interface
Describes the USB audio interface capabilities.
12 Channel USB Input
Receives 12 channels of audio via USB, mixed with analog inputs.
12 Channel USB Output
Sends 12 channels of audio via USB, post-fader.
